Wisconsin Beef Council Reveals Top 8 in Sizzling 'Best Burger Contest'
VERONA, Wis. (WBAY) -- The Wisconsin Beef Council has announced the Elite Eight finalists for their 2nd Annual Wisconsin’s Best Burger Contest. Two teams among the Elite Eight come from northeast Wisconsin. Created to honor and encourage 100% beef burgers made in Wisconsin’s eateries, taverns, and barbecue spots, this competition has garnered attention from burger lovers across the state.
